What is the difference between Ndt Eddy Current vs Ndt Ultrasonic Technician?

AspectNdt Eddy CurrentNdt Ultrasonic Technician
CertificationsLevel I/II in Eddy Current Testing, ASNT certificationLevel I/II in Ultrasonic Testing, ASNT certification
Work EnvironmentNon-destructive testing of conductive materials, often in manufacturing and maintenanceInspection of welds, thickness measurements, often in aerospace, oil & gas
Industry UsageMetal fabrication, power plants, aerospacePipeline, aerospace, manufacturing

Both Ndt Eddy Current and Ndt Ultrasonic Technician roles require similar certifications and work in non-destructive testing environments. Eddy Current testing primarily examines conductive materials for surface and near-surface flaws, while Ultrasonic testing uses high-frequency sound waves to detect internal defects. The choice depends on the material and defect type being inspected.

What are some common challenges faced by NDT Eddy Current technicians during inspections, and how can they be addressed?

NDT Eddy Current technicians often encounter challenges such as signal noise interference, variations in material properties, and accessibility issues in complex geometries or confined spaces. Addressing these challenges typically involves careful calibration of equipment, selecting appropriate probe types, and collaborating closely with engineers or other NDT professionals to interpret ambiguous results. Continuous training and hands-on experience help technicians develop the expertise needed to troubleshoot issues and ensure accurate defect detection in various industrial settings.

What is NDT Eddy Current testing?

NDT Eddy Current testing is a non-destructive testing (NDT) method that uses electromagnetic induction to detect flaws, measure thickness, and assess the conductivity of conductive materials, such as metals. By passing a coil carrying an alternating current near the material, eddy currents are induced in the material, which react to changes in its properties like cracks or corrosion. This technique is widely used in industries such as aerospace, manufacturing, and power generation to ensure structural integrity without damaging the components being tested.
